Technical Advancements in Photovoltaic Inverters
The latest 4400W solar inverters now achieve 98.2% conversion efficiency – a 3.5% improvement from 2020 models. Let's examine this breakthrough through real-world data:
Parameter | 2020 Model | 2024 Model |
---|---|---|
Peak Efficiency | 94.7% | 98.2% |
Startup Voltage | 120V | 80V |
MPPT Channels | 2 | 4 |

FAQ: 4400W Solar Inverters
- Q: Can this inverter handle battery storage systems? A: Yes, most modern models support hybrid solar-battery configurations.
- Q: What maintenance does it require? A: Annual inspections and periodic firmware updates ensure optimal performance.
